Baltimore homicide detectives are investigating after the body of a 28-year-old woman was found in a plastic container in the backyard of her home.

Officials said they were called around 4:30 p.m. Thursday to a home in the 1100 block of Gorsuch Avenue for a possible homicide investigation. The detectives received information that someone had been killed and that the deceased’s body was at that location.

Upon arrival, detectives were granted access to the home and performed a search, officials said. Police said they located a large plastic container in the rear yard of the home with human remains inside.

Mason Moldoven, 28, who lived at the location, was pronounced dead at the scene and her remains were transported to the Medical Examiner’s office. Police said it appears the victim had been stabbed.

Homicide detectives are investigating this incident and are asking anyone with information to call detectives at (410)396-2100 or call Metro Crime Stoppers at 1-866-7lockup.
